Upgrade the VM-Series Model
The licensing process for the VM-Series firewall uses the UUID and the CPU ID to generate a unique serial
number for each VM-Series firewall. Hence, when you generate a license, the license is mapped to a specific
instance of the VM-Series firewall and cannot be modified.
In order to apply a new capacity license to a firewall that has been previously licensed, you need to clone the
existing (fully configured) VM-Series firewall. During the cloning process, the firewall is assigned a unique
UUID, and you can therefore apply a new license to the cloned instance of the firewall.
Use the instructions in this section, if you are:
Migrating from an evaluation license to a production license.
Upgrading the model to allow for increased capacity. For example you want to upgrade from the VM-200 to
the VM-1000-HV license.
If you have purchased an evaluation auth-code, you can license up to 5 VM-Series firewalls with
the VM-1000-HV capacity license for a period of 30 or 60 days. Because this solution allows you
to deploy one VM-Series firewall per ESXi host, the ESXi cluster can include a maximum of 5
ESXi hosts when using an evaluation license.
Upgrade PAN-OS Version
1. From the web interface, navigate to Device > Licenses and make sure you have the correct VM-Series firewall license
and that the license is activated.
On the VM-Series firewall standalone version, navigate to
Device > Support and make sure that you have activated
the support license.
2. To upgrade the VM-Series firewall PAN-OS software, select
Device > Software.
3. Click
Refresh to view the latest software release and also review the Release Notes to view a description of the
changes in a release and to view the migration path to install the software.
4. Click
Download to retrieve the software then click Install.
